À¶Ý®ÊÓÆµ's Strategic Mandate Agreement (SMA3 2020-2025)

SMA3 between the Ministry of Colleges and Universities and University of À¶Ý®ÊÓÆµ is a key component of the Ontario government’s accountability framework for the post-secondary education system.

SMA3:

  • outlines provincial government objectives and priority areas for the postsecondary education system
  • describes the elements of Ontario's performance-based funding mechanism, including the University's annual performance-based funding notional allocation for the five-year 2020 to 2025 Strategic Mandate Agreement (SMA3) period
  • establishes the corridor mid-point that will form the basis of enrolment-related funding over the five-year SMA3 period
  • supports transparency and accountability objectives
  • establishes allowable performance targets for 10 metrics upon which institutional performance will be assessed
